Noam and Jen are back for 2025! While it feels like it has been a few months since we last recorded it has only been a few weeks, we can't help that the internet had no chill over the holidays.
We get back into the groove by discussing the current SCOTUS case that will decide if TikTok US will be allowed to continue after 1/19, the legal arguments on both sides of the case, the viability of China owning a social media platform that operates in the US, how far can 1st Amendment and national security arguments be stretched, ByteDance sacrificing TikTok US before they will sell, and what the potential blowback will be if TikTok goes bye-bye.
Relatedly, we discuss Mark Zuckerberg's big announcement about the changes coming to content moderation and internal operations at Meta, his newfound hero status in certain circles, playing the victim on Rogan, and why he's striking this tone now (hint - it's related to the TikTok case).
Lastly we discuss the wildfires currently burning in parts of Los Angeles, DEI water distribution, politicians who can't handle a crisis, how fires work, the importance of fixing immediate issues first, and how this is all the environmentalists' fault.
